Package org.apache.hadoop.hbase

Interface Summary
Cell The unit of storage in HBase consisting of the following fields:
CellScannable Implementer can return a CellScanner over its Cell content.
CellScanner An interface for iterating through a sequence of cells.
KeyValue.SamePrefixComparator<T> Avoids redundant comparisons for better performance.
Stoppable Implementers are Stoppable.
 

Class Summary
AuthUtil Utility methods for helping with security tasks.
BaseConfigurable HBase version of Hadoop's Configured class that doesn't initialize the configuration via BaseConfigurable.setConf(Configuration) in the constructor, but only sets the configuration through the BaseConfigurable.setConf(Configuration) method
CellComparator Compare two HBase cells.
CellUtil Utility methods helpful slinging Cell instances.
Chore Chore is a task performed on a period in hbase.
CompoundConfiguration Do a shallow merge of multiple KV configuration pools.
HBaseConfiguration Adds HBase configuration files to a Configuration
HBaseInterfaceAudience This class defines constants for different classes of hbase limited private apis
HConstants HConstants holds a bunch of HBase-related constants
KeyValue An HBase Key/Value.
KeyValue.KVComparator Compare KeyValues.
KeyValue.MetaComparator A KeyValue.KVComparator for hbase:meta catalog table KeyValues.
KeyValue.RawBytesComparator This is a TEST only Comparator used in TestSeekTo and TestReseekTo.
KeyValue.RowOnlyComparator Comparator that compares row component only of a KeyValue.
KeyValueTestUtil  
KeyValueUtil static convenience methods for dealing with KeyValues and collections of KeyValues
NamespaceDescriptor Namespace POJO class.
NamespaceDescriptor.Builder  
NoTagsKeyValue An extension of the KeyValue where the tags length is always 0
TableName Immutable POJO class for representing a table name.
Tag Tags are part of cells and helps to add metadata about the KVs.
TagType  
 

Enum Summary
HConstants.Modify modifyTable op for replacing the table descriptor
HConstants.OperationStatusCode Status codes used for return values of bulk operations.
KeyValue.Type Key type.
 

Exception Summary
HBaseIOException All hbase specific IOExceptions should be subclasses of HBaseIOException
 

Annotation Types Summary
MetaMutationAnnotation The field or the parameter to which this annotation can be applied only when it holds mutations for hbase:meta table.
VersionAnnotation A package attribute that captures the version of hbase that was compiled.
 



Copyright © 2015 The Apache Software Foundation. All Rights Reserved.